Bangladesh: Undersecretary Benedetto Della Vedova to visit Dhaka (10 November 2016)

The Undersecretary of State for Foreign Affairs, Benedetto Della Vedova, will visit Dhaka on 10 November to meet the authorities of Bangladesh and the Italian community, four months after the violent terrorist attack in which 22 civilians were killed, including 9 Italian citizens. Minister Gentiloni today in Marseille for the “Dialogue 5+5” ministerial meeting

Foreign Minister Paolo Gentiloni was in Marseille today to attend the 13th Foreign Affairs Ministerial meeting for Dialogue in the Western Mediterranean (“Dialogue 5+5”). Other participants include the Foreign Ministers of France, Malta, Algeria, Tunisia, Mauritania, Libya and the Secretaries of State of Spain and Portugal. Lake Chad: Italy allocates 6.3 million euros for emergency actions in favour of Boko Haram victims

Italy has allocated 6.3 million euros for emergency actions in the four countries of the Lake Chad Basin, namely Nigeria, Cameroun, Chad and Niger, which are facing the consequences of Boko Haram’s radical and extremist violence.
